Output 630c0905a735d6d3dea4acd0153b3b52c851c18df5f4b7b1ef64660c6e02e83d:20

value
284360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b4a4c7302d7e19f5e7693e34b5850066226816 OP_EQUAL
address
3Bxx1NSxNn4hYPDLmVS2vqdhELUwfma9zY
transaction
630c0905a735d6d3dea4acd0153b3b52c851c18df5f4b7b1ef64660c6e02e83d
spent
true